In January 2018, my Department entered into a five year financial commitment of €10 million to establish four Climate Action Regional Offices, CAROs. One of these CAROs covers the Atlantic seaboard north region, encompassing the local authorities of Galway city and counties Galway, Mayo, Sligo, and Donegal. Mayo County Council is the lead local authority for Atlantic Seaboard North CARO. While I have had no direct interaction to date with the North Atlantic Seaboard CARO, my Department engages with all four CAROs on a regular basis, in particular through participation in the National Local Authority Climate Action Steering Group, and the CARO Steering Group, at which all aspects of the CARO work programme are discussed. My Department approves the CARO work programmes and is in frequent contact with each CARO to monitor progress in delivery. Under the National Adaptation Framework each local authority developed an adaptation strategy. These strategies are now being implemented, and each CARO is working with the local authorities in its region to both facilitate and monitor implementation of the local climate adaptation actions within the strategies.
